West Baden Springs town, Indiana Population By All Races in Census 2020

Updated on June 29, 2023.

According to the data from the US 2020 decennial Census, in April 2020, among West Baden Springs town, IN population of 541 people, 89.46% (484 people) identified their race as White Alone, 5.92% (32 people) identified their race as Two Or More Races, and 3.70% (20 people) identified their race as Black or African American Alone.
